Character and identity

Spread across 30,000 acres of working cattle ranch in the North Platte River Valley, flanked by the Sierra Madre and Medicine Bow ranges, this all-inclusive guest ranch trades on remoteness and Western craft. The 45 accommodations split between 19 rooms in the Trailhead Lodge and private one- to four-bedroom cabins scattered across the property, each guest assigned a golf cart for getting around. Architecture nods to the 1884 Sterrett homestead: log construction, antler chandeliers, stone fireplaces, fur throws. The Cheyenne Club restaurant at The Farm anchors the dining, the Trailhead Spa handles wellness, and the Saloon pulls everyone together at night for pool and live music.

Who's it for

Best for:
Multi-generational families, couples after a genuine screen-free reset, and groups buying out the property for weddings or company retreats. If you want twice-daily guided activities (fly fishing, horseback riding, ATVing, clay shooting), a serious culinary programme built around ranch-raised American Wagyu and an on-site distillery, and 300-plus staff for 150 guests, this fits.

Should look elsewhere:
Anyone wanting a quick weekend pop-in: it's a three-hour drive from Denver, and the remoteness is the point. Skip it if you need city energy, beach, nightlife, or a heavily wired room product. Travellers who balk at all-inclusive pricing for a ranch stay should also reconsider.

Bottom line

The defining feature here is the integration of serious cooking and a Wagyu programme with genuine wilderness immersion, backed by a staff-to-guest ratio that makes personalisation effortless. Spring for a private cabin over a Trailhead Lodge room if you're travelling as a couple or family wanting space and porch time. Summer books out first; winter rates and the private ski hill are the quieter play.
